About the Opportunity

DMI is seeking a skilled and customer-focused Service Desk Analyst – Tier 2 to support a federal client in Arlington, VA. This position plays a key role in resolving complex technical issues and providing escalated support to end users. The ideal candidate will have 4–5 years of relevant experience, strong technical troubleshooting skills, and a commitment to delivering excellent service.

 

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Provide advanced (Tier 1) technical support for hardware, software, and other issues.
  • Analyze, troubleshoot, and resolve more complex IT incidents and service requests through phone, email, and remote tools.
  • Maintain and update records in the ticketing system (ServiceNow), ensuring accurate documentation of all issues and resolutions.
  • Work collaboratively with other IT teams, to escalate and resolve persistent or critical problems.
  • Identify recurring issues and recommend improvements to reduce future incidents.
  • Monitor system performance and user feedback to proactively address potential issues.

Qualifications

Education and Years of Experience: 

  • 4–5 years of experience in a Service Desk or technical support role, with a strong track record in Tier 1 support.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office products and Windows Operating Systems.
  • Solid experience with ServiceNow or similar IT Service Management (ITSM) platforms.
  • Strong understanding of desktop support concepts, including user account management, permissions, and troubleshooting system applications.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to work independently and in a team environment.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and resolve issues under pressure.

Preferred Skills:

  • Previous experience supporting federal government clients.
  • Must be able to work flexible shifts, including nights and weekends, as needed.
  • Ability to obtain a security clearance.

Additional Requirements:Successful completion of a Public Trust background investigation and/or a Public Trust clearance.

 

Min Citizenship Status Required: US Citizenship Required

 

Physical Requirements: No Physical requirement needed for this position.

Location: Arlington, VA
